After I upgrade to Parallels Desktop 19, I am not able to see any android adb device when connected an Android ADB enabled device on Ubuntu 22.04 Guest OS on MacOS 13.5.2 (with 2.4 GHz 8-Core Intel Core i9).
From dmesg, I am seeing the USB is keeping reconnected, but no other error found from kernel. Tried to disable USB 3.1 support, not helping.
The Guest OS was installed on Parallels Desktop 18, and no issues with it before, and downgrade to Parallels Desktop 18 fixed the issue without changing anything on the Guest OS.
Any idea what happen?
